What is WMAFunct.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file, like WMAFunct.dll, is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. WMAFunct.dll specifically contains functions and resources related to Windows Media Audio (WMA) files. When a program like Amazon MP3 Downloader needs to work with WMA audio files, it can access the functions and resources in WMAFunct.dll instead of writing its own code from scratch.

This makes the program more efficient and helps conserve memory because the same code can be shared by multiple programs. In the context of Amazon MP3 Downloader, WMAFunct.dll plays a crucial role in enabling the software to handle WMA audio files. Without WMAFunct.dll, Amazon MP3 Downloader would need to include its own code to work with WMA files, leading to larger program size and potentially slower performance.

By utilizing WMAFunct.dll, Amazon MP3 Downloader can efficiently manage WMA files without duplicating code, making the software more streamlined and effective in handling a variety of audio file formats.

DLL files, fundamental to our systems, can sometimes lead to unexpected errors. Here, we provide an overview of the most frequently encountered DLL-related errors.

  • Cannot register WMAFunct.dll: This suggests that the DLL file could not be registered by the system, possibly due to inconsistencies or errors in the Windows Registry. Another reason might be that the DLL file is not in the correct directory or is missing.
  • WMAFunct.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.
  • WMAFunct.dll not found: The system failed to locate the necessary DLL file for execution. The file might have been deleted or misplaced.
  • The file WMAFunct.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
  • This application failed to start because WMAFunct.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
